Eileen Gu turns heads with stunning look at Milan Fashion Week after Winter Olympic gold and ‘traitor’ controversy

- Advertisement -

Eileen Gu was ever the golden girl on Wednesday when she traded her skis for stilettos at Milan Fashion Week

The freestyle skier continued to wow in Italy following her success at the Winter Olympics where she claimed a gold medal and a pair of silvers under intense scrutiny from her critics. 

The 22-year-old remained in Milan this week but instead of stunning fans with her skills on the slopes, she turned heads with her style. 

Gu, who controversially represents China over the United States where she was born, has stayed booked and busy following the end of the Milan-Cortina Games as she turned her focus to her ‘other job’ at Milan Fashion Week. 

The Olympic champion attended her first event of the fashion extravaganza in the Italian city, when she strutted into the Brunello Cucinelli on Wednesday. 

Gu looked ethereal in an ivory, floor-length silk shift dress with a halter neckline and backless detail that accentuated her athletic frame.

She paired the gown with a cropped moto leather jacket, fusing a daring edge to the chic look.

Gu was warmly welcomed to the show as a guest of honor, with Brunello Cucinelli, the designer of the luxury Italian fashion brand, personally heralding her arrival. 

The designer posed with the Team China athlete, holding her arm in the air in a gesture that seemingly recognized her recent triumphs. 

Gu, the most-decorated female Olympic freestyle skier, has shared following her final event that, with the success of the Games now behind her, she would be dedicating her attention to her ‘other job.’ 

The halfpipe Olympic champion is staying in Milan from February 24 to March 2 for the city’s Fashion Week, where she made her catwalk debut back in 2023. 

‘It’s Fashion Week in Milan,’ Gu said, via AFP. ‘I have the other job, the other fashion thing.

‘I’m really excited to just explore some other avenues, be creative, and explore my femininity through fashion, which is something I’ve always loved, and to kind of put that in juxtaposition with skiing and with sports.

‘And I think they co-exist so beautifully and so I hope to represent that next week in Milan.’

While Gu has established herself as a force on the slopes, she has also emerged as a fashion darling. 

In addition to being a decorated Olympian and a student at Stanford University, Gu is also an IMG-signed model, having graced the covers of the Chinese editions of Harper’s Bazaar, Elle, Cosmopolitan, GQ and Vogue. 

She has also been featured in campaigns for Fendi, Gucci, Tiffany & Co. and Louis Vuitton, and is a founding member of the VS collective. 

Gu has also attended some of the biggest fashion events across the globe, including the Met Gala red carpet in 2022 and Paris Fashion Week in 2023. 

Her treasure trove of luxury sponsorships reportedly earned her a staggering $23 million last year alone, per Forbes.

However, her success and fame have thrust her under the microscope with her sponsorships and wealth coming under intense scrutiny, especially in the wake of her decision to compete for China. 

As her wealth explodes, so does the vitriol from back home, where critics and former athletes have begun openly labeling the San Francisco-born skier a ‘traitor.’
